The Astronomy Behind Infinite Working day and Unlimited Evening



The phenomena of limitless daylight and prolonged darkness are immediate outcomes of Earth’s axial tilt and orbital mechanics. Earth is tilted somewhere around 23.five degrees relative to the airplane of its orbit round the Sunshine. This tilt—not the distance in the Solar—is the key driver of seasonal variation. As Earth revolves per year throughout the Sun, different hemispheres alternately tilt towards or from incoming solar radiation, developing shifts in both equally temperature and day duration.

At latitudes earlier mentioned 66.5° north and south—regarded respectively since the Arctic Circle and also the Antarctic Circle—the lean has an Excessive impact. All through community summertime, the pole tilts toward the Solar sufficiently that photo voltaic declination stays higher more than enough for that Sun to remain over the horizon for an entire 24 hrs or maybe more. This constant illumination is known as the midnight Sunshine. The closer just one moves towards the pole, the for a longer period the length of uninterrupted daylight. Within the geographic poles on their own, the Solar rises when at the spring equinox and stays obvious, tracing a slow round path while in the sky, until it sets with the autumn equinox—resulting in approximately 6 months of daylight.

The reverse occurs for the duration of local Winter season. Any time a pole tilts far from the Sunshine, photo voltaic declination turns into inadequate to bring the Sunlight earlier mentioned the horizon. This produces polar evening, a period of time during which the Sunlight won't increase in any respect. Yet again, period raises with latitude. Near the poles, darkness can persist for months, while It isn't absolute; civil twilight should still present dim illumination based on the Sunlight’s angle underneath the horizon.

The key astronomical variable governing these extremes is solar declination—the angular place on the Solar relative to Earth’s equatorial airplane. As declination oscillates between +23.5° and −23.5° throughout the year, areas near the poles periodically enter zones wherever Earth’s curvature helps prevent dawn or sunset from developing.

These patterns are mathematically predictable and repeat yearly with precision. But their experiential repercussions—months outlined by one dawn or sunset—display how a modest axial tilt generates a lot of the World’s most dramatic environmental contrasts.

Organic Clocks Under Pressure



Human physiology is structured around circadian rhythms—endogenous, approximately 24-hour cycles regulated from the suprachiasmatic nucleus (SCN) within the hypothalamus. This internal pacemaker synchronizes bodily processes such as hormone secretion, sleep–wake timing, Main temperature, metabolism, and cognitive alertness. Its Most important environmental cue, or zeitgeber, is light-weight. Less than usual disorders, the day by day sample of dawn and sunset reinforces circadian alignment. In areas going through midnight Sunlight or polar night, that external sign will become distorted or disappears entirely.

For the duration of intervals of steady daylight, exposure to persistent light-weight suppresses melatonin secretion, the hormone chargeable for advertising and marketing snooze onset. With out a very clear signal of darkness, people today normally practical experience delayed rest phases, insomnia, and fragmented relaxation. Your body’s inner clock may drift afterwards on a daily basis, creating a form of “social jet lag,” specially when operate schedules continue to be fixed. Cortisol rhythms, Ordinarily peaking each morning to promote alertness, can flatten or change, impacting energy regulation and temper balance.

Conversely, extended darkness for the duration of polar night cuts down gentle-mediated stimulation from the SCN. Lessen mild intensity—specially inside the blue spectrum—can dampen circadian amplitude and add to hypersomnia, lethargy, and diminished cognitive sharpness. Seasonal Affective Disorder (Unfortunate) is more widespread at greater latitudes, reflecting how diminished photoperiod influences serotonin exercise and mood regulation. Synthetic light will become a therapeutic intervention as opposed to a convenience; timed vivid-light publicity is often prescribed to stabilize circadian timing.

Over and above slumber and mood, metabolic procedures are affected. Circadian misalignment has actually been related to impaired glucose regulation, urge for food disruption, and altered immune function. For communities residing less than Severe photoperiods, structured routines—preset sleep schedules, managed light-weight exposure, and deliberate darkness for the duration of relaxation periods—function compensatory mechanisms.

Importantly, adaptation takes place. Residents of substantial-latitude locations frequently acquire behavioral strategies that buffer biological pressure: blackout curtains in summer months, light therapy in Winter season, and culturally embedded routines that impose temporal composition when natural cues are unreliable. Nevertheless, the pressure is serious. The circadian method advanced less than predictable cycles of sunshine and dark; when People cycles prolong to months or months, biology must negotiate among environmental extremes and inside equilibrium.

Architecture, Structure, and Constructed Natural environment



In locations defined by midnight Sunlight and polar evening, architecture is not really merely aesthetic—it really is adaptive infrastructure. Properties will have to compensate for environmental extremes that disrupt biological rhythm, psychological balance, and day-to-day operation. The built surroundings gets a mediating layer involving celestial mechanics and human habitability.

Light-weight management is central. In areas of steady daylight, residential and business constructions generally include blackout systems, layered curtains, and adjustable shading to simulate nighttime. Bedrooms are developed as controlled darkness zones, enabling circadian alignment even if the exterior stays vivid. Conversely, for the duration of polar night time, architecture prioritizes gentle amplification. Significant south-struggling with Home windows (in the Northern Hemisphere), reflective inside surfaces, and strategic synthetic lights units improve out there illumination. High-lux, full-spectrum lights is routinely used indoors to counteract seasonal temper drop and retain alertness.

Thermal performance is equally crucial. Intense cold during extended darkness calls for remarkable insulation, triple-glazed Home windows, airtight envelopes, and heat recovery air flow devices. Electricity-successful layout is just not optional—it determines survival and economic sustainability. Compact city setting up lowers heat loss and publicity, even though interconnected structures permit motion devoid of consistent exposure to severe temperature.

Shade and materials choice also impact psychological properly-getting. In lengthy winters, interiors normally element warm tones, natural Wooden, and tactile components that counteract environmental austerity. Public Areas might include lively façades to offset monochromatic landscapes dominated by snow or darkness. Throughout infinite summer season light, shading products, deep overhangs, and cool-toned interiors average sensory intensity.

City design and style adapts also. Avenue lighting in polar night time need to equilibrium security with Visible convenience, staying away from glare from snow and ice. Public accumulating spaces develop into anchors of social cohesion, compensating for seasonal isolation. In higher-latitude towns like Tromsø and Reykjavík, civic setting up intentionally integrates cultural venues, Winter season festivals, and pedestrian-friendly layouts to sustain exercise In spite of climatic constraints.

Finally, architecture in Severe latitudes performs a regulatory functionality. It restores rhythm in which mother nature withholds it, softens environmental severity, and constructs psychological continuity. In doing so, the developed ecosystem turns into not merely shelter, but a deliberate extension of human adaptation to astronomical extremes.

Cultural Adaptation and Id



In locations shaped through the midnight Sunshine and polar night time, society doesn't simply endure environmental extremes—it absorbs them into identification. Light-weight and darkness become over atmospheric problems; they functionality as Arranging metaphors for community, resilience, and belonging.

Seasonal contrast usually constructions cultural calendars. Summertime festivals, out of doors gatherings, and athletic situations intensify during limitless daylight, transforming abundance into celebration. In northern Norway, as an example, communities in Tromsø maintain live shows and community functions beneath the midnight Sunshine, framing frequent light-weight to be a image of vitality and openness. The ecosystem becomes an active participant in collective experience.

Conversely, polar night cultivates interiority. Traditions emphasize heat, storytelling, craft, and communal intimacy. In Icelandic Modern society centered all-around Reykjavík, Wintertime gatherings, literary society, and inventive generation prosper for the duration of prolonged darkness. As opposed to resisting the period, cultural methods reinterpret it as being a period of reflection and artistic depth.

For Indigenous Arctic communities, including the Sámi persons throughout northern Scandinavia, seasonal extremes are embedded in cosmology, subsistence designs, and social Business. Migration cycles, reindeer herding rhythms, and ceremonial traditions align with environmental transitions. Right here, adaptation is not reactive—it is ancestral awareness formalized into id.

Language by itself usually encodes environmental nuance. Vocabulary might differentiate refined variants of light, snow, or seasonal alter, reinforcing environmental literacy throughout generations. These linguistic precision displays lived intimacy with Severe conditions.

Importantly, resilience results in being a shared narrative. Enduring months of darkness or navigating perpetual daylight is framed for a marker of toughness and communal solidarity. The setting shapes not only habits but in addition collective self-conception: to belong is to withstand.

Modern-day infrastructure and world-wide connectivity have softened environmental hardship, however cultural id stays seasonally anchored. Residents routinely describe psychological attachment on the rhythm of extremes—missing the midnight Solar’s Vitality when absent, or finding comfort and ease inside the contemplative stillness of polar night time.

Eventually, extreme seasons cultivate cultures that don't look for uniformity with temperate norms. In its place, they Create id all around distinction. Mild and darkness become dual forces shaping custom, creativity, and social cohesion—reworking astronomical phenomena into enduring cultural which means.
